概括
米粉内9 (flo9) 突变体揭示了一种新的蛋白质模块,OsLESV-FLO6,对于粉颗粒形成和谷物中烯酸胺生物合成至关重要.

背景情况:
- 谷物谷物中的粉合成涉及多种酶,它们作用于粉颗粒中的粉质.
- 通过粉合成酶进入这些颗粒的精确机制,特别是粉蛋白生物合成,仍然在很大程度上未被阐明.
研究的目的:
- 在粉生物合成中研究米粉内精子9 (flo9) 基因的功能.
- 为了确定分子参与者和机制,控制酶访问粉颗粒在米内.
主要方法:
- 米 (Oryza sativa) 面粉精子9 (flo9) 的突变分析.
- 分子克隆和蛋白质同质分析.
- 生物化学测定粉结合和蛋白质相互作用.
- 基因相互作用的遗传分析.
主要成果:
- 这种flo9突变体表现出有缺陷的烯胺生物合成,导致具有空心的粉状内.
- FLO9编码了OsLESV,一种与Arabidopsis LESV同源的植物特异性蛋白质,对于粉颗粒在米内中开始起作用至关重要.
- OsLESV直接与粉结合,并与粉结合蛋白FLO6相互作用. 任何基因的功能丧失突变都会阻碍ISOAMYLASE1 (ISA1) 向粉颗粒.
- OsLESV和FLO6协同作用,调节粉生物合成和内的发育.
结论:
- OsLESV-FLO6形成了一个非酶模块,对于将ISA1定位到粉颗粒至关重要.
- 这种OsLESV-FLO6模块在调节粉生物合成和米内精子发育方面发挥着至关重要的作用.
- 已识别的OsLESV-FLO6模块是生物技术应用的潜在目标,用于控制米粒中的粉含量和成分.
